European Market Analysis

Market Trends

The European market for avocado oil has been steadily growing as consumers become more health-conscious and seek out natural, organic products. According to a report by Market Research Future, the European avocado oil market is expected to reach a value of $120 million by 2025,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9.2% from 2020 to 2025.

Key Players

Several key players dominate the European avocado oil market, including companies like Olivado, Chosen Foods, La Tourangelle, and Bio Planète. These companies have established strong distribution networks and brand recognition, making it challenging for new entrants to compete in this competitive market.

Export Strategies

Avocado oil exporters targeting the European market often focus on premium quality products, organic certifications, and sustainable sourcing practices to appeal to health-conscious consumers. They also collaborate with local distributors and retailers to ensure widespread availability and visibility of their products in key European countries like Germany, France, and the United Kingdom.

Asian Market Analysis

Market Trends

The Asian market for avocado oil is also experiencing significant growth, driven by the increasing awareness of the health benefits of avocado oil and its rising popularity in skincare and beauty products. According to a report by Grand View Research, the Asian avocado oil market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 10.5% from 2021 to 2028, reaching a value of $90 million by 2028.

Key Players

In the Asian market, key players such as AvoPacific, Ahuacatlan, and BioFinest dominate the avocado oil industry, leveraging their strong brand presence and innovative product offerings to capture market share in countries like China, Japan, and South Korea. These companies often focus on premium packaging and unique marketing strategies to differentiate their products in a crowded market.

Export Strategies

Avocado oil exporters targeting the Asian market face unique challenges related to cultural preferences, regulatory requirements, and distribution channels. To succeed in Asia, exporters need to adapt their products to local tastes, establish partnerships with reputable importers and distributors, and navigate complex trade barriers to ensure a smooth entry into key Asian markets.

Challenges and Opportunities

Challenges

One of the main challenges faced by avocado oil exporters targeting premium markets in Europe and Asia is the intense competition from established brands and manufacturers. Additionally, exporters must navigate complex regulations, tariffs, and quality standards in each market, which can be time-consuming and costly. Furthermore, logistical challenges such as transportation, storage, and packaging can also impact the export process.

Opportunities

Despite these challenges, there are numerous opportunities for avocado oil exporters to capitalize on the growing demand for high-quality, natural products in Europe and Asia. By focusing on premium quality, sustainability, and innovation, exporters can differentiate their products and capture market share in these lucrative regions. Additionally, the rise of e-commerce platforms and online marketplaces provides exporters with new avenues to reach consumers directly and expand their global reach.
